最近在学laravel,做一下学习笔记。

1、contains()方法判断集合是否包含给定的项目:

$collection = collect(['name' => 'Desk', 'price' => 100]);var_dump($collection->contains('Desk'));// truevar_dump($collection->contains('New York'));// false

2、你也可以用 contains 方法匹配一对键/值,即判断给定的配对是否存在于集合中:

$collection = collect([    ['product' => 'Desk', 'price' => 200],['product' => 'Chair', 'price' => 100],]);var_dump($collection->contains('product', 'Bookcase'));// false


转载于:https://www.cnblogs.com/chaoyong/p/7975484.html

laravel contains 的用法相关推荐

  1. php laravel框架开发实例,Laravel框架集合用法实例浅析

    本文实例讲述了Laravel框架集合用法.分享给大家供大家参考,具体如下: 前言 集合通过 Illuminate\Support\Collection进行实例,Laravel的内核大部分的参数传递都用 ...

  2. laravel翻看php日志,关于Laravel的日志用法

    这篇文章主要介绍了Laravel日志用法,结合实例形式较为详细的分析了Laravel日志的功能.定义.使用方法与相关注意事项,需要的朋友可以参考下 本文实例讲述了Laravel日志用法.分享给大家供大 ...

  3. laravel的pluck用法

    pluck方法为给定键获取所有集合值: $collection = collect([['product_id' => 'prod-100', 'name' => 'Desk'],['pr ...

  4. Laravel中Request用法

    //以数组形式获取所有输入数据 $request()->all();//input从整个请求中获取输入数据(包括查询字符串) $request()->input('name'); //设置 ...

  5. php swoole 项目实战,Laravel 中使用 swoole 项目实战开发案例一 (建立 swoole 和前端通信)...

    最近使用swoole做了项目,里面设计推送信息给界面前端,和无登陆用户的状态监控,以下是本人从中获取的一点心得,有改进的地方请留言评论. 1 开发需要环境 工欲善其事,必先利其器.在正式开发之前我们检 ...

  6. jsp项目开发案例_Laravel 中使用 swoole 项目实战开发案例一 (建立 swoole 和前端通信)life...

    1 开发需要环境 工欲善其事,必先利其器.在正式开发之前我们检查好需要安装的拓展,不要开发中发现这些问题,打断思路影响我们的开发效率. 安装 swoole 拓展包 安装 redis 拓展包 安装 la ...

  7. jsp项目开发案例_Laravel中使用swoole项目实战开发案例一 (建立swoole和前端通信)

    Laravel中使用swoole项目实战开发案例二(后端主动分场景给界面推送消息) 工欲善其事,必先利其器.在正式开发之前我们检查好需要安装的拓展,不要开发中发现这些问题,打断思路影响我们的开发效率. ...

  8. lumen 项目根目录_Lumen 初体验(二)

    最近使用 Lumen 做了 2 个业余项目,特此记录和分享一下. Lumen 的介绍 在使用一项新的技术时,了解其应用场景是首要的事情. Lumen 的口号:为速度而生的 Laravel 框架 Lum ...

  9. lavaral中文手册_Laravel-mix 中文文档

    概览 基本示例 larave-mix 是位于webpack顶层的一个简洁的配置层,在 80% 的情况下使用 laravel mix 会使操作变的非常简单.尽管 webpack 非常的强大,但大部分人都 ...

最新文章

  1. 线性方程 最小二乘解 SVD分解
  2. C++中调用DLL中的函数的两种方式
  3. 【鬼网络】之Linux网络设置
  4. ORA-00257 错误解决
  5. 如何将 SAP UI5 应用托管到 Github 网站上并运行
  6. 防止html标签转义
  7. 基于Mint UI和MUI开发VUE项目一之环境搭建和首页的实现
  8. ASP.NET数据库编程入门
  9. Nginx 介绍与Linux下安装配置
  10. bowtie1和bowtie2的比较
  11. too many connections的一个实践
  12. kettle工具的设计原则
  13. 石家庄计算机学院生活费每月多少,石家庄高校每月生活费约1000元
  14. 网页设计\网页制作常用软件大全
  15. maya表情blendshape_【Maya】角色表情绑定-BlendShape的使用技巧
  16. 阿里 P9 揭秘职场晋升:明明一样做好了本职工作,只有我一直不被提拔?
  17. 性能测试线上培训班怎么选 3点教你在线选好培训班
  18. 有n堆石子,每次取出两堆合成一堆,每堆石子的个数即为合并石子所需要耗费的体力,求出合并所有石子堆所需要耗费的最小体力
  19. redis,Spring Cache,Mango,ES
  20. 千里之行,始于驭风——咕咚新款21k驭风跑鞋体验

热门文章

  1. (三十一)web 开发基础项目
  2. parallels desktop
  3. [Angularjs]angular ng-repeat与js特效加载先后导致的问题
  4. 作为技术人员,经常遇到没有接触过的技术,有时是点滴的小技能,有时可能是大的一个研究课题,那么我们如何进行技术研究呢?
  5. 哪吒之魔童降世视听语言影评_豆瓣评分8.7,这个“新哪吒”不一般|《哪吒之魔童降世》影评...
  6. Java 并发编程之自定义线程池 ThreadPoolExecutor
  7. SpringCloud Consul Config 配置中心 (二)
  8. Oracle varchar类型数值排序问题
  9. UNI使用蓝牙连接设备传输数据
  10. 代码居中对齐_HTML span标签如何居中和右对齐?这里有HTML span标签的样式解析